Abstract:
"This thesis expounds on the lack of characterization and representation for black characters in animation. When viewing a character in an animated film or show viewers are drawn to characters that look like them in appearance and lifestyle. For this train of thought, it is a negative and positive based on what role the character is playing in the animation and what they look like. The issue is that there aren't that many positive representations or characterizations of black characters in animation, because of this it causes a disruption on identity. Leading to common stereotypes of black characters. This thesis will explore academic surveys and studies on racial representation in animation. Further, the elementary is participating in a survey on racial profiling in animation. This information will be beneficial to animators when creating a character of color and able to expand skin color, body type, facial features, and personality traits. These academic surveys and studies in addition to the elementary school survey will be analyzed to further investigate how to positively represent
African Americans in animation." -- Abstract
